Description

Duties:


In-Office Requirement**:

The U.S.

Postal Service, Office of Inspector General values collaboration, teamwork, and effective communication to foster our dynamic working and learning environment.

The position adheres to our agency's telework policy to facilitate this and requires an in-office presence of at least two days per pay period.

Remote work is not available for this role.

This position is being advertised at the Journey Band level, equivalent to a GS-9 to GS-13. The salary range for this position is $68, $153, The salary figures include locality pay. The salary figures include locality pay. Promotion potential to a GS-13 equivalent is at management's discretion.


Please note that the duties and responsibilities associated with this position may vary based upon the agency's needs at the time of hire.

The following description of major duties and responsibilities is only intended to give applicants a general overview of the expectations.


  • Leverage USPS and 3rd party data sets to identify trends, risks, significance, and appropriate solutions for complex issues that involve major areas of uncertainty in approach, methodology, or interpretation
  • Design experiments, tests hypotheses, and build scalable models using data science and artificial intelligence (e.g. machine learning, natural language processing, computer vision)
  • Design and maintain data pipelines to support machine learning systems
  • Monitor model performance for data drift and other anomalies and design systems to track performance and usage of ML models
  • Operationalize machine learning models by deploying them in production environments
  • Automate model training, deployment, and monitoring
  • Develop statistical models and methodologies to predict, quantify, and evaluate various business metrics in support of audit, investigative, and business objectives
  • Provide expertise and assistance in integrating advanced analytics working with leadership teams to find best in class business solutions
  • Use relational databases, data lakes, and other data environments to wrangle large and disparate data sets to create a variety of analytic products and visualizations such as business intelligence tools, summary tables, comparison graphs, and link analysis charts
  • Present analytic findings to the organization through understandable reports and visualizations
  • Assess new technologies for solving business problems, including conducting proof of concepts to assess applicability, quality, and functionality
  • Research, design, develop, adapt, and enhance analytical and reporting solutions using a range of analytics techniques, methods, and tools
  • Make recommendations regarding how data is collected, used, and managed
  • Use expert level knowledge to identify and develop sources of information from structured and unstructured data, criminal intelligence databases, public information sources, internal Postal Service databases, reference manuals, and audit and law enforcement reports
  • Develop and review written materials (such as reports, special analyses, proposals) and presentations to convey information, make recommendations and improvements concerning complex programs and functions to internal and external audiences, demonstrating varying levels of understanding of the organization's programs and activities
  • Prepare comprehensive documentation for requirements, test plans, user manuals, technical diagrams, and training materials

Qualifications:


M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
You must meet ALL of the minimum qualifications listed below.

  •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university

AND

AND

  • Must have proven ability to thrive in a fastpaced environment with multiple priorities utilizing project management processes

AND

  • Must have 1 year of specialized experience in using an objectoriented programming language (Python (preferred), R, Scala, Rust, or Java) for data science and/or machine learning projects

AND

  • Must have 1 year of specialized experience with ML frameworks and libraries (e.g. TensorFlow, PyTorch, or Scikitlearn)

AND

  • Must have 1 year of specialized experience developing and presenting analytically derived findings to a business audience utilizing business intelligence tools such as PowerBI (preferred), Tableau, Qlik, or other similar products

DESIRABLE QUALIFICATIONS

  • Practical experience with cloud platforms such as Azure (preferred), AWS, or GCP
